uW Translation Notes:

Note 1 topic: figures-of-speech / genericnoun

אַ֭לְמָנָה וְ⁠גֵ֣ר & וִֽ⁠יתוֹמִ֣ים יְרַצֵּֽחוּ

widow and_[the],sojourner & and,fatherless_ones (Some words not found in UHB: widow and_[the],sojourner kill and,fatherless_ones murder )

Here, the widow and the sojourner and the fatherless represent vulnerable people in general, not specific individuals. If it would be helpful to your readers, you could use expressions that would be more natural in your language. Alternate translation: [widows and sojourners & they murder those without fathers]

Note 2 topic: figures-of-speech / doublet

אַ֭לְמָנָה וְ⁠גֵ֣ר יַהֲרֹ֑גוּ וִֽ⁠יתוֹמִ֣ים יְרַצֵּֽחוּ

widow and_[the],sojourner kill and,fatherless_ones (Some words not found in UHB: widow and_[the],sojourner kill and,fatherless_ones murder )

The terms kill and murder mean similar things. The psalmist is using the two terms together for emphasis. If it would be clearer for your readers, you could express the emphasis with a single phrase. Alternate translation: [They kill the widow, the sojourner, and the fatherless]
